Frames damaged or cracked

If a uPVC frame is damaged, it can allow water and air into the house. It can also allow cold air to escape and warm air to be absorbed, leading to more energy costs. In some instances, a replacement window will be required to restore the integrity. A reliable uPVC company can often solve the problem by implementing a cost-effective, simple solution.

It is best to contact an expert as soon as you can to fix a broken window. This will prevent moisture from getting into your home and causing more damage. If the glass of the double-paned window is not damaged it can be fixed by using adhesive or a putty. If the glass has cracked the glass must be replaced as quickly as is possible.

It is recommended to regularly check your windows to look for signs of cracks and window repairs near me warping. Contact a uPVC expert right away if you observe any of these issues. They can help you determine whether your window requires repairs or replacement, and advise the best course of action to take.

Leaking Sealed Units

The glass panes in modern double-glazed windows are sealed together to form a single unit called an IGU (insulated glazing unit). If the seal breaks then you will begin to see condensation between the panes of glass. Condensation is a sign that the inert gas between the panes has evaporated, and warm air from your home is making its way in. The window will be functional, but it won't function as well as it did before the seal was damaged. This type of problem cannot be fixed and the IGU has to be replaced.

This is not a DIY project and should be left to professionals that have worked with IGUs for a long time. They will be able to replace the IGU within the frame, without having to tear the entire window out.
